Book Cheap Royal Air Maroc flight from Marrakech (RAK) to Toronto (YYZ) from CA $831

Find The Best Day to Book a Cheap Royal Air Maroc Flights From Marrakech to Toronto

Cheapest Royal Air Maroc Flights from Marrakech (RAK) to Toronto (YYZ)

The cheapest flights to Pearson Intl. found within the past 7 days were round trip and CA $831 one way. Prices and availability subject to change. Additional terms may apply.

Grab a great Royal Air Maroc flight from RAK to YYZ 

To find a great deal on Royal Air Maroc flights with Travelocity, simply enter your origin and destination airports, pick your travel dates, and hit search. From here, you can sort by price, flight duration, and arrival/departure time. You can also filter to find nonstop flights. 

Flying Royal Air Maroc Marrakech to Toronto gives you fights to choose from. With that direct flight time of , you’ll be touching down before you know it.  

 

Find cheap flights with Royal Air Maroc between Marrakech and Toronto 

Royal Air Maroc has a range of great fares on stacks of flights, and to find the most affordable for you, there are a few tricks you can try. Booking in advance, for example, is a great way to grab a fantastic deal. Also, choose the cheapest month, if you can. One-way flights from Marrakech to Toronto with Royal Air Maroc are November.  

The more flexible you are, the more affordable flights you’re likely to find. Consider one-way flights and connecting flights, as well as standard roundtrip and direct options. Even if you’re flying today, cheap last-minute flights are easy to find by entering your travel dates and hitting search.  

 

Reasons to book your Royal Air Maroc flights with Travelocity 

Travelocity makes it easy to book a seat, anywhere in the world. The vast inventory, fast search, and advanced filters put some of the best deals on the planet in one place. Whether you’re traveling on business, with friends, family, or on your own, take your pick from some fantastic options. And with free cancellation and pay later options, you can travel more and worry less.  

Royal Air Maroc Airports
Hop on a(n) Royal Air Maroc flight today by flying to many destinations out of these domestic and international airports:
Airport code
Country
Airport name
Number of flights
DMERUSDomodedovo Intl.9
FCOITAFiumicino - Leonardo da Vinci Intl.2
CMNMARMohammed V2
DOHQATHamad Intl.1
ICNKORIncheon Intl.1
CMBLKABandaranaike Intl.1
SINSGPChangi1
OMSRUSTsentralny1
FLLUSAFort Lauderdale - Hollywood Intl.1
CTAITAFontanarossa1

Travelers ❤️ these 🏨 after their flight to Toronto

Hilton Toronto Airport Hotel & Suites
Hilton Toronto Airport Hotel & Suites
4 out of 5
5875 Airport Road, Mississauga, ON
Book a stay at this eco-certified hotel in Mississauga. Enjoy breakfast (surcharge), a free airport shuttle, and a fitness center. Our guests praise the pool ...
8.2/10 Very Good! (2,942 reviews)
"Good!"

Reviewed on 21 Mar. 2025

Hilton Toronto Airport Hotel & Suites
Hampton Inn & Suites by Hilton Toronto Airport
Hampton Inn & Suites by Hilton Toronto Airport
2.5 out of 5
3279 Caroga Dr, Mississauga, ON
Book a stay at this eco-certified hotel in Mississauga. Enjoy free breakfast, free WiFi, and a free airport shuttle. Our guests praise the breakfast and the ...
8.2/10 Very Good! (1,473 reviews)
"Shuttle. Late checkout by one hour"

Reviewed on 20 Mar. 2025

Hampton Inn & Suites by Hilton Toronto Airport
Holiday Inn Toronto - Int'l Airport by IHG
Holiday Inn Toronto - Int'l Airport by IHG
3.5 out of 5
970 Dixon Rd, Toronto, ON
Stay at this 3.5-star spa hotel in Toronto. Enjoy free WiFi, a full-service spa, and breakfast (surcharge). Our guests praise the helpful staff and the clean ...
8.2/10 Very Good! (1,880 reviews)
"Lovely stay. Having a restaurant on site was great. Staff were nice. Place was clean."

Reviewed on 21 Mar. 2025

Holiday Inn Toronto - Int'l Airport by IHG
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
*Price based on the lowest price found within past 24 hours and based upon one night stay for two adults over the next thirty days. Prices and availability subject to change. Additional terms may apply.